For a satin look (i do like the wet look more) but 303 Aerospace Protectant will protect your tires from UV and other stuff.
I keep meaning to buy it and try it out. I have used it on my dash though (no Armoral for me). It makes it have a satin shine to it and cleans great.

But really with tires, will the tread/tire even last long enough for you to use the tire shines for them to crack before you buy new ones? I really like the Eagle One Tire Wet...I used somethin else today though cuz I seem to have misplaced the tire swipe.

Yes it is true. Petroleum will eat the rubber and dry it out.

But you will wear out your tires before that happens.

Armorall for your dash is bad because the alcohol in the armorall wipes or spray dries out the dash material and causes it to crack or become faded and damaged
